Solano County Biographies WILLIAM FERGUSON Transcribed by Kathy Sedler This file is part of the California Genealogy & History Archives http://www.rootsweb.ancestry.com/~cagha/index.htm born on Province, New Brunswick, Canada, Sept. 11, 1872 [? clearly typed as this date], where he received his education, and learned the carriage maker�s trade, which he followed until October, 1865, when he went to Massachusetts, and resided about one year. In 1866 he returned to Canada, on a visit, and from here came to California, arriving in San Francisco Nov. 29, 1866, and from here to Mission San Jose, and followed his trade for about 8 months. He then returned to San Francisco, where he remained for a short time, and then came to this county, locating in the fall of 1867, taking up his abode in Binghamton, where he resided for two years. He then went to Sacramento, where he remained about 5 months; thence to Rio Vista, in March, 1879, where he has resided ever since, with exception of one year, (part of 1870 and 1871), up to the present time. He carried on wagon-making and blacksmithing. Married August 19, 1874, Miss Mary Cook, of Rio Vista. She was born Aug. 15, 1853, in Province, Canada. Have 2 children, Mary Edith, born June 1, 1876; William C., born July 19, 1877. History of Solano County�. � San Francisco, Cal. - Wood, Alley & Co., East Oakland, pub 1879, pp 471-472
